Formula evaluation in Calcwright runs inside the Penfold sandbox. No user expression touches the host interpreter. Allowed functions are whitelisted in the sandbox manifest; anything else raises a hard fault. CPU is capped at 50ms per evaluation, memory at 8MB. Escapes via string templating were closed in the v4 parser rewrite — verify the regression suite still covers them. Review the manifest diff on every release. The full threat model and bypass history are documented on the internal page below.

dashboard of tawef-hagug = https://superset.norvadyn.local/display/projects/build/ticket/build/spaces/ticket/1e989f0e6c200d20fc4ae06b

**AI-7: Reconcile job backoff.** The Cartwheel inventory reconciler retried stale-ledger conflicts with no jitter, hammering the Morrow warehouse shard until it tipped over. Fix adds exponential backoff with jitter and a per-run conflict budget; exceeding the budget aborts and alerts rather than looping. Reviewer: please confirm the abort path releases the partition lock. Proposed constants are below.

tuning constants:
QUOTAS = {
    "druwyn": 5,
    "holix": 5,
    "zorath": 5,
    "holwyn": 10,
}

Beginning next fiscal year, customers on legacy Fernwick contracts will see a 12% price increase, phased over two renewal cycles. Roughly 640 accounts are affected, most in the Greymarsh territory. Modeled churn is 4–6%, offset by upgrade incentives to the Fernwick Plus tier. Talking points and objection-handling scripts will be distributed two weeks before notices go out. Exceptions require regional director approval. A confidential note on related business plans appears directly below this briefing.

internal memo for yahaf-hawif: The finance team signed off on a budget of $59.9 million for Project Rusax.